Device Information

Viewing Device Information

You can view the unit ID, software version, and license
agreement.
Select Setup > About.

Updating the Software

Before you can update the handheld device or collar software,
you must connect the handheld device
(page
16) to the computer.
You must update the software on the handheld device and
collar separately.
NOTE: Updating the software does not erase any of your data
or settings.
1
Go to www.garmin.com/products/webupdater.
2
Follow the on-screen instructions.

Device Care

Do not store the device where prolonged exposure to extreme
temperatures can occur, because it can cause permanent
damage.
Never use a hard or sharp object to operate the touch screen,
or damage may result.
Avoid chemical cleaners and solvents that can damage plastic
components.

Cleaning the Device

1
Wipe the device with a cloth dampened with a mild detergent
solution.
2
Wipe it dry.
Cleaning the Screen
Before you can clean the screen, you should have a soft, clean,
lint-free cloth and water, isopropyl alcohol, or eyeglass lens
cleaner.
Apply the liquid to the cloth, and gently wipe the screen with the
cloth.

TT 10 Dog Collar Device Specifications
Battery type
Rechargeable, replaceable lithium-ion
Battery life
20 hours with a 2.5-second update rate; 40
hours with a 2-minute update rate
Operating temperature
From -4°F to 140°F (from -20°C to 60°C)
range
Charging temperature
From 32°F to 113°F (from 0°C to 45°C)
range
Short-term storage
From -4°F to 104°F (from -20°C to 40°C)
temperature range

Battery Information
This product contains a lithium-ion battery. To prevent the
possibility of personal injury or product damage caused by
battery exposure to extreme heat, store the device out of direct
sunlight.
Do not use a sharp object to remove batteries.
Contact your local waste disposal department to properly
recycle the batteries.
Long-Term Storage
The normal long-term decrease in the charging capacity of
lithium-ion batteries can be accelerated by exposure to elevated
temperatures. Storing a fully charged device in a location with a
temperature outside the long-term storage temperature range
can significantly reduce its recharging capacity. See
When you do not plan to use the handheld device for several
months, the battery should be removed. Stored data is not lost
when the battery is removed.
When you do not plan to use the collar for several months, the
battery should be charged to about 50%. The device should be
stored in a cool, dry place with temperatures are around the
typical household level. After storage, the collar should be fully
recharged before use.

Adjusting the Backlight Brightness
Extensive use of screen backlighting can significantly reduce
battery life. You can adjust the backlight brightness to maximize
the battery life.
NOTE: The backlight brightness may be limited when the
battery is low.
1
Select the Power key.
2
Use the slider to adjust the backlight level.
The device may feel warm when the backlight setting is high.
Adjusting the Backlight Timeout
You can decrease the backlight timeout to maximize the battery
life.
1
Select Setup > Display > Backlight Timeout.
2
Select an option.
